Welcome to the Fennwick plugin program. All schema migrations against the Orchardgate store must be zero-downtime: additive changes ship first, dual-write logic runs for at least one release, and destructive steps wait for sign-off from the Fennwick migrations board. Before your plugin can register a migration plan, it must authenticate to the migration broker using the key that appears below.

service key, yadug-bajog: zpat3_pou

CI note for support: the Quillbridge GraphQL N+1 regression is fixed. The orders resolver now batches vendor lookups via a dataloader, cutting query counts from ~400 to 3 per request. If customers still report slow order pages, confirm they're on the patched release before escalating. Pipeline is green as of this morning. Reference the trace token below when filing follow-ups.

build token for kagaf-hahof: htk14_9d3d4d26d7d8de

**Action item (owner: release manager):** The Larkspindle export job rendered all report timestamps in server-local time again, so the Quenby office got reports shifted by nine hours. Before the next release, gate exports behind the timezone-normalization check and add it to the ship checklist. Details and test cases are written up here.

runbook for badug-kadup: https://confluence.zemvarlabs.internal/projects/browse/display/projects/bd1b

Q: How do we unlock SquintGuard's quarantine review console?

For the eng sync: when our typo-squatting scanner quarantines a suspect package, the review console seals itself to prevent tampering. Any engineer on rotation may unseal it, provided the action is logged in the weekly notes. To unseal the console, enter the recovery passphrase below.

vault phrase of bagaf-kajeg = jorath-feniel-briir-siliel-ralix